Abstract
PLC (Power line communication) is a technology that provides high speed communication of voice and data and its is very cost effective method. It has been successfully implemented in many applications in real time. In this project one such application is used to digitize an institution by replacing circulars or notice boards by digital notice boards. Frequent updating is easy with a centralized systems. Data's are sent through existing power line to a particular power line node or various nodes. The information is obtained from server and it is displayed using LCD at the reception. when a message is received it is intimated to students using a voice board. A personal Computer, power line modem, voice board and an LCD display are used to design digital notice board via power line.
